My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Johnston is a young 8-9 month old yellow lab that was pulled from a rural kill shelter after he was dumped there. This poor boy went through such a tough time, trapped in a dingy dark shelter for over a month, terrified of everyone and everything. He came to us completely shut down. No idea how to interact with people or other dogs. But he is learning how to be a dog now. Still a little slow to warm up to people, Johnston is learning that people are not here to hurt him. He loves other dogs and learns well from them. So an owner that is committed to social things like daycare and dog parks, or a home with another dog, would be ideal.

He is neutered, chipped, UTD on shots, HW neg, and fully vetted. His adoption fee is $250
